
Mako TV News is a student production of Nova Southeastern University’s Department of Communication, Media, and the Arts.
On this episode, the NSU music program has been revamped to focus more on commercial music, CIA Operative Felix Rodriguez speaks at the Alvin Sherman Library, as the volleyball season begins we got the opportunity to speak with sibling duo Gabrielle and Erica Spankus about their relationship on and off the court, in honor of Hispanic heritage month we ask our sharks about their Hispanic culture, and more.
